A Contemporary Industrial Bedroom Makeover for a Toy Collector

For collectors, especially for those who are into toys and figures, space and storage solutions are of utmost importance when it comes to designing a room. As one’s trove may have a lot of rare and expensive pieces, the area has to be safe and secure for items on display.

This loft is an unused area located in the bedroom of the owner, who happens to be a collector of Funko Pop and Hot Toys, among others. 

Before


Interior designer Sharlene Lanzarrote was tasked with the makeover. “Since his room has technically two levels, we decided to completely turn the upper level into a sleeping and lounge area,” she says in an email to Real Living. “In order to make a warmer and cozier atmosphere, we installed PVC wood ceiling panels to make the space look like a contemporary log cabin. The upper level only houses his bed, a reading nook, and a piano.”

The lower level is where work and play happen.

“As a collector, one of the most interesting features when buying a special figure is the art box. Our client specifically wanted to feature art boxes... We also added a frameless glass cabinet with built-in LED strip lights to showcase his collection and protect them from dust as well.” Ample shelving is provided for Funko Pops and other kits.
